Output 16e86931dbdabfcb9677ecca7d48b8d38b70a8b6b229480c2f08268a53456e51:0

value
5801047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c186833004ca6c669883d9074c8cdae665df557 OP_EQUAL
address
3A5yL2EwgdBFMm6AwYWCn7E7LsYZb4PqKb
transaction
16e86931dbdabfcb9677ecca7d48b8d38b70a8b6b229480c2f08268a53456e51
confirmations
265156
spent
true